WebAug 29, 2024 · Adaptive work equipment: Work equipment like ergonomic keyboards and chairs can help you feel more comfortable and may help ease symptoms while working at a desk. Low physical demand: A job that requires minimal physical strain can help alleviate arthritis pain. For example, a desk job with a swivel chair can provide greater comfort … sharps in e major scale

WebOsteoarthritis can affect anyone at any age, but it's more common in women over the age of 50. ... There are also working splints to support the joint at the base of the thumb. If you have osteoarthritis in the joint at the base of your thumb, a splint can be helpful. Although you may not notice the benefit straight away, research shows a thumb ... Knee arthritis is known to affect joint functionality causing knee pain and even leading to … sharps injury nhs protocolWebJan 8, 2016 · 3. Maintain a Healthy Body Weight. Carrying excess body weight puts strain on joints that are already delicate.
